From Friday evening to Monday morning, Warsaw road crews will replace the pavement on Górczewska Street near the “Moczydło” pools, closing the lane toward the city centre and diverting buses and traffic.
Roadworks on Górczewska Street
On Friday, 17 October evening until Monday, 20 October morning, Warsaw road crews will replace the surface of Górczewska Street near the “Moczydło” swimming pools. Heavy machinery will work on the shoulder closer to the pools, and the intersection with Elekcyjna Street will also be closed, extending the overall segment slightly beyond the initial closure.
Closed passage to the city centre
At 10 pm on 17 October, the southbound lane of Górczewska toward the city centre—from Ciołka Street to Archbishop Tysiąclecia Avenue—will be closed. Vehicles coming from Bem will be diverted onto Jan Olbrahct Street, but may also turn left onto Księcia Janusza and Ciołka Streets. Drivers heading toward Elekcyjna will only reach Bitwy pod Lenino Street. From Deotymy and Ciołka onto Górczewska only right turns toward Bem are allowed.
The detour runs via Jan Olbrahct, Redutowa, and Wolska Streets to Archbishop Tysiąclecia Avenue. Residents of Bem can bypass the closed section via Powstańców Śląskich to Połczyńska and Wolska or to Wrocławska, Radiowa, Dywizjon 303, and Obozowa, then onto Archbishop Tysiąclecia Avenue or Młynarska. The repaired lane opens at 4:00 am on Monday, 20 October.
Bus routes altered
During the works, buses on lines 129 and 249 will avoid the intersection of Górczewska and Deotymy, instead proceeding along Ciołka Street toward Koło. Lines 171 and 190 heading toward Torwar and CH Marki will turn onto Ciołka, travel to Obozowa, then return to their standard routes via Archbishop Tysiąclecia Avenue. Line 184 buses, in both directions, will run parallel to their normal path through Jan Olbrahct and Redutowa Streets.
Lines 523 toward Olszynka Grochowska and N43 toward Central Station will deviate early, turning onto Jan Olbrahct, then traveling Redutowa and Wolska, rejoining their routes at the PKP Wola stop. Night line N42 toward Central Station will leave Redutowa for Wolska, then through Archbishop Tysiąclecia to Górczewska.
Additional works on Powstańców Śląskich
Road crews will also work on a section of Powstańców Śląskich Street at the same time. Lines 171, 184 and N43 will have detours on that stretch as well.
